2005 Honda Accord question.
 

I was originally in the market to purchase a 2004 Accord EX v6 until I
heard of the recalls regarding the transmission.

My question is will this problem be fixed for the new 2005's that come
out after September? Or is there a chance they will be recalled down the
line as well? -- My thinking is that knowing exactly what the problem
is, Honda would be able to correct it before shipping the new 2005's
out. But I might be offbase here.

I really like the car, but don't want the hassle of a recall.

Anyone have some insight on this?

Thank you in advance.


CaptainKrunch 08-17-2004 03:30 AM

Re: 2005 Honda Accord question.
 
The recall fixes the problem and the recalls were done prior to the cars
leaving the factory once the problem was discovered

An 04 at this point will already have the work completed.
